Arctic Blue vs Chios Meadow Brown
Agriades aquilo compared with Maniola chia
Key Differences
- Arctic Blue is Near Threatened while Chios Meadow Brown is Least Concern.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Arctic Blue | Chios Meadow Brown |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class same | Insecta (Insects)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order same |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Lycaenidae |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ies) |
| Genus | Agriades | Maniola |
| Species | Agriades aquilo | Maniola chia |
Evolutionary Relationship
Arctic Blue and Chios Meadow Brown share a common ancestor at the Order level: Lepidoptera. (Butterflies & Moths)
